The Scottish Football League Division Two was played for the 47th time in 1952/53 . After the introduction of Division One , it was also the 47th edition of the men's second-highest football division in the Scottish Football League under the name Division Two . In the 1952/53 season 16 clubs competed against each other in a total of 30 game days. Each team played once at home and away against every other team. The 2-point rule applied . In the event of a tie, the goal quotient counted . The championship won Stirling Albion , which together with the runner-up Hamilton Academical secured promotion to Division One. The top scorer with 26 goals was James Cunningham of Alloa Athletic .
